    15 Miami-Dade Public School Staff Members Die Of COVID In Just 10 Days
    “It’s a tremendous loss,” said one education official of the death of a 30-year teacher.
    headshot
    By Mary Papenfuss
    09/04/2021 10:15 pm ET

    15 Miami-Dade Public School Staff Members Die Of COVID In Just 10 Days | HuffPost

    excerpt:

    "A 30-year teaching veteran was one of 15 Miami-Dade County public school staff members who died of COVID-19 in just 10 days as Florida continues to reel amid the continuing, overwhelming toll of an unfettered pandemic.

    “It’s a tremendous loss,” said a school official, referring to the death of longtime teacher Abe Coleman, 55, earlier this week.

    “The number of lives that he impacted are countless. So many young men had the benefit of him intervening in their lives and pointing them in the right direction,” Marcus Bright, who works with a local education program 5000 Role Models of Excellence, told NBC-6 TV.

    Coleman taught at Holmes Elementary School in Miami’s Liberty City area, which is a primarily Black neighborhood with 42% of the population living below the poverty line.

    Local education officials haven’t released the identities of the other teachers or staff members."

    The investigation of possible Trump corruption in Georgia is ongoing.


    Georgia DA Investigates Trump’s Call to ‘Find’ Votes

    excerpt:

    "A local criminal investigation into then-President Donald Trump’s attempt to meddle with Georgia’s 2020 election recount is inching forward, as Fulton County investigators have interviewed elections officials and received documents from the agency, according to three people with direct knowledge of the probe.

    “They’ve asked us for documents, they’ve talked to some of our folks, and we’ll cooperate fully,” Georgia Secretary of State Brad Raffensperger told The Daily Beast this week.

    Fulton County District Attorney Fani Willis previously revealed to The Daily Beast that she has spun up a new anti-corruption team to explore what state laws, if any, were broken when Trump and his allies tried to overturn election results there. But her office has been quiet about the matter in the five months since.

    Her investigators have since interviewed at least four officials at the secretary of state’s office, asking questions that show a particular interest in Raffensperger’s separate phone conversations with Trump and U.S. Senator Lindsey Graham, according to two of these sources, who spoke on the condition of anonymity."

    Trump appointed three conservatives on the Supreme Court and embarked on a relentless, evidence-lacking campaign of alleging voter fraud. The majority of state legislatures are controlled by the GOP. Eighteen states have followed Trump's lead and have passed restrictive voting legislation..


    Democrats counter Republican-led voter restrictions with early, aggressive outreach

    excerpt:

    "The raft of new Iowa measures, signed into law by Republican Governor Kim Reynolds in March and June, significantly reduce the power of local election officials and threaten criminal penalties if they do not comply. The laws shave an hour off poll openings and the time workers can take off to vote, and limit boxes where people can drop ballots to one per county.

    The day after Iowa's law came into force, the League of United Latin American Citizens sued in state court, claiming it violates the state constitution's guarantee of the right to vote and that the fraud rationale was simply a ploy to suppress voters. In Iowa, there were just 27 convictions for various types of election misconduct, including fraud, since 2016, according to government figures.

    The group's Iowa political director Joe Enriquez Henry, said the law targets those who are more likely to vote absentee or lack flexible working hours, including the elderly, multiple-job holders and the poor.

    "It appears Republicans don't want democracy to prevail," he said."
